After losing her job at a high-end restaurant, a headstrong sous-chef reluctantly accepts a job in the cafeteria of a shelter for young migrants. While she is frustrated by her new position, her skills and passion for cuisine start to change the young men’s lives.
French with English subtitles.
100 mins, rated M.
